Stoichiometry and assembly of mTOR complexes revealed by single-molecule pulldown #MMPMID25453101
Jain A; Arauz E; Aggarwal V; Ikon N; Chen J; Ha T
Proc Natl Acad Sci U S A 2014[Dec]; 111 (50): 17833-8 PMID25453101show ga
The mammalian target of rapamycin (mTOR) kinase is a central regulator of cell growth, differentiation, and metabolism. mTOR is assembled into two distinct complexes, mTORC1 and mTORC2. Using single-molecule pulldown (SiMPull), we have determined the stoichiometric composition of mTORCs under growth and stress conditions. We find that both mTORC1 and mTORC2 form obligate dimers, in which major components exist in two copies per complex. Importantly, SiMPull allowed us to distinguish complex disassembly from stoichiometry changes, providing insights into the effects of physiological conditions and the drug rapamycin on mTOR complexes.
